Imagine asking a friend: "Do you want yummy sweet strawberries, or yucky green beans?"
That is not fair! You pushed them to pick strawberries before they even had a chance to think.

A survey is a list of questions we ask people to find out what they think or like.
A good survey must be fair, which means it does not tilt the answer toward one side.
What happens when a question tries to nudge you toward an answer?
Leading Questions
A leading question tries to lead you to one special answer, like giving a big hint.
If you ask, "Don't you agree that dogs are the cutest pets?", you are telling them to say yes.

To make it fair, simply ask: "What is your favorite pet?" and let them choose.
